What is the best strategy to win monopoly?

Develop property as aggressively as you can. Buy orange and red properties, as they are the most landed-on. Don’t save your money. Don’t bother with utilities. Develop three houses or hotels as quickly as possible. Later in the game, don’t try to get out of jail right away.

Does monopoly have strategy?

Monopoly: A Game of Strategy…Or Luck? A popular board game since 1935, Monopoly is a game that may be dependent on both luck and strategy. A player can bet on his or her own luck alone, think carefully and buy up strategic properties, or use strategy to complement his or her luck to gain dominance in the game.
